Undergrad options for international students

Hey guys, going to apply to a few schools in the USA, would like some safe school recommendations that would still be able to get me into boutique IBD and or private credit shops. Looking forward to hearing your recommendations

2 Comments
 

There are incredibly comprehensive lists of semi targets and non targets all over this forum, recommend doing a search. Recruiting as an international is tough but school doesn't have a ton to do with that, obviously go to the best school you can and do a STEM-eligible major for the longer visa time but there aren't schools with way better pipelines for internationals or anything
